Understanding Your 2004 Nissan Altima Stereo Wiring Diagram
A 2004 Nissan Altima Stereo Wiring Diagram is essentially a visual map of the electrical connections within your vehicle's audio system. It identifies each wire by its function and color, showing where it originates and where it needs to connect on your new stereo unit. Without this diagram, you'd be left guessing, potentially leading to blown fuses, damaged equipment, or a non-functional stereo. The importance of using the correct wiring diagram cannot be overstated for a safe and effective installation.
These diagrams typically break down the connections into several key categories. You'll find information on:
- Power Wires: Constant 12V (for memory), Ignition 12V (for turning the stereo on/off with the car).
- Ground Wire: Essential for completing the circuit.
- Speaker Wires: Front left positive and negative, front right positive and negative, rear left positive and negative, rear right positive and negative.
- Illumination Wire: To dim the stereo display when headlights are on.
- Antenna Power: To power an electric antenna if applicable.

When you’re ready to install your new stereo, this diagram will be invaluable. You’ll use it to identify the corresponding wires on your aftermarket stereo harness and connect them accordingly. Many aftermarket stereos come with their own wiring harnesses, and you’ll often need to splice these into the factory Altima harness based on the information provided in the 2004 Nissan Altima Stereo Wiring Diagram . This might involve using wire connectors, solder, or heat shrink tubing for a secure connection. It's a process that requires patience and attention to detail, but with the diagram in hand, it becomes a manageable task.
